In Prints: Japanese Art and Culture

The Colby College Museum of Art, the Five College Center for East Asian Studies, and the Friends of Aomori invite K-12 in-service educators to join us for a professional development workshop on Japanese print making.

The workshop will include scholar Ankeney Weitz, Ziskind Professor of East Asian Studies and Art; Chair of East Asian Studies at Colby College, discussing the history of Japanese printmaking; group tours of the Colby College printmaking studio and a related print exhibition at the Colby College Museum of Art; Alison Johnson, Director of School Programs at Island Readers and Writers on Visual Thinking Strategies and the Whole Book Approach (using Freeman Book Award winners); and a hands-on printmaking activity.
